
EU to begin easing sanctions against Syria
The EU will gradually begin easing sanctions against Syria. The decision was made during a meeting in Brussels.

The EU is preparing a large diplomatic mission to visit the Syrian capital Damascus, with the aim of establishing contacts with the new leadership of the country, the EU High Representative for Foreign Affairs and Security Policy Kaja Kallas said.
Türkiye will receive 1 billion euros, Syria will get less than 110 million euros, Ursula von der Leyen announced. These funds will be allocated by the European Commission for the restoration of countries affected by the catastrophic earthquake. Europe's assistance to Türkiye and Syria will not end there.
